From cd408d9c96df8c9b99203e6964dff76a3c1217af Mon Sep 17 00:00:00 2001 From: Kovid Goyal Date: Sat, 18 Mar 2017 08:43:07 +0530 Subject: [PATCH] Fix a typo that caused dynamically updated metadata source plugins to stop working. Fixes #1673884 [Amazon Metadata Plugin Not Used When "metadata-sources-cache.json" Exists](https://bugs.launchpad.net/calibre/+bug/1673884) --- src/calibre/customize/ui.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/calibre/customize/ui.py b/src/calibre/customize/ui.py index f8e4f17c07..72b7202b50 100644 --- a/src/calibre/customize/ui.py +++ b/src/calibre/customize/ui.py @@ -624,7 +624,7 @@ def patch_metadata_plugins(possibly_updated_plugins): pup = possibly_updated_plugins.get(plugin.name) if pup is not None: if pup.version > plugin.version and pup.minimum_calibre_version <= numeric_version: - patches[i] = pup + patches[i] = pup(None) for i, pup in patches.iteritems(): _initialized_plugins[i] = pup # }}}